Can I intern in us without opt?
If an internship is properly “unpaid” within the DOL rules, then it is not “employment” and therefore does not require a foreign student to be “employment authorized,” i.e., F-1 Optional Practical Training (OPT) or Curricular Practical Training (CPT); or J-1 Academic Training.

Can an international student work off campus in US with SSN?
Students in valid F-1 cannot be employed off-campus without meeting eligibility requirements and obtaining official authorization. Immigration regulations severely limit the international student’s eligibility to accept employment off-campus.

Can you get SSN without job?
Eligibility for a Social Security Number
Only non-citizens authorized to work in the U.S. are eligible for a Social Security number. Those with a non-employment based temporary visa without authorization to work in the U.S. are not permitted to apply for a social security number.

Can a F-1 student get SSN?
If you are in F-1 status and do not have lawful F-1 employment, you are ineligible to apply for a SSN. This includes applications for replacement SSN cards. J-1 students are required to show evidence of employment and must be in valid J-1 status and be registered for a full course of study.

How many days does it take to get SSN after applying?
within two weeks
You should receive your SSN card within two weeks after we have everything we need to process your application, including verification of your immigration document with the USCIS. If we are unable to immediately verify your immigration document with the USCIS, it may take two additional weeks to receive your card.
Can I hire an employee with an ITIN?
Employers cannot accept an ITIN as a valid employee identification for work eligibility. The IRS will penalize companies and resident and non-resident aliens who use ITINs for U.S. employment verification purposes. Anyone assigned an ITIN who becomes eligible to work in the U.S. must apply for a social security card.
Can I work legally with an ITIN?
An ITIN does not provide legal immigration status and cannot be used to prove legal presence in the United States. An ITIN does not provide work authorization and cannot be used to prove work authorization on an I-9 form.

Does SSN expire?
Does an SSN expire? No. Once an SSN has been assigned it is an individual’s unique number for the rest of his or her life in the United States. However, the individual’s work authorization may expire.
